Nagargawan is a Rural village located in Dalsinghsarai, Samastipur, Bihar.
The total population of Nagargawan is 4,842.
Nagargawan village comprises 930 households.
The literacy rate in Nagargawan is 58.6%. Among the literate population of 2,314, there are 1,321 literate males and 993 literate females.
In Nagargawan, there are 2,515 males and 2,327 females, with a sex ratio of 925 females per 1000 males.
There are 892 children (18.4% of population), comprising 459 boys and 433 girls.
The total number of workers in Nagargawan is 1,580, with 986 main workers and 594 marginal workers.
In Nagargawan, there are 1,519 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(760 males, 759 females) and 14 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(10 males, 4 females).
Nagargawan is located in Bihar state, Samastipur district, and falls under Dalsinghsarai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 237042 and LGD code is 237042.
